What's the most rare lightsaber?

The rarest lightsaber color is bronze.

The Wookie Jedi Knight named Lowbacca created this unique lightsaber for himself and used it throughout the Yuuzhan Vong War. He's Chewbacca's nephew, trained by Luke Skywalker at the Jedi Praxeum on Yavin 4 after the Galactic Civil War.

Is there a pink lightsaber?

A pink lightsaber or a magenta lightsaber, is a rare lightsaber blade color. In Star Wars Canon, Cal Kestis may optionally wield a magenta-bladed lightsaber in the video game Star Wars Jedi: Fallen Order (2019). In Star Wars Legends, the first Mara Jade lightsaber emits a magenta blade.

Who had a black lightsaber?

The Darksaber goes back to the time of Tarre Vizsla, the first Mandalorian to become a Jedi Knight. He created a one-of-a-kind lightsaber with a flat blade of dark, swirling energy. In the Star Wars Rebels episode “Trials of the Darksaber,” Fenn Rau shared more of the Mandalorian folklore surrounding the weapon.

Are there Brown lightsabers?

A brown lightsaber is an extremely rare lightsaber blade color in Star Wars Legends. The Bnar's Sacrifice kyber crystal gives a lightsaber a brown blade. Brown-bladed lightsabers do not currently exist in Star Wars Canon.
